DutiesHelp
- You will serve as a management advisor using high-level of discernment and judgment to address a wide variety of interrelated subject matter that include financial, contractual, programmatic, or other program office focus areas.
- You will attend high level meetings as a senior authoritative representative of acquisition programs.
- You will provide a wide range of substantive oral and written presentations and reports to internal and external stakeholders.
- You will develop and implement overall program requirements based on new or revised legislation.
- You will analyze and evaluate effectiveness of program requirements throughout the lifecycle.
- You will make determinations on resources to accomplish program objectives and apply technical expertise to various levels or operations.
- You will develop and implement improvement and efficiency strategies for programming, budgeting and procurement based on findings from key program specialists and analyst.
- You will perform program reviews and recommend improvements to production and programmatic deficiencies.
- You will identify and facilitate potential solutions and evaluate technical, cost, and schedule implications of each viable solutions.
- You will work with complex software and hardware-intensive development programs, relevant areas of technology evolution, modernization, capability improvements and ship modernization and maintenance to meet specific requirements.
- You will oversee the administration of contracts, award of new contracts and establish budget priorities.
- You will identify problems, develop solutions, communicate and aggressively implement actions plans to deliver capability in a fast-paced environment is essential.
RequirementsHelp
Conditions of employment- Must be a US Citizen.
- Must be determined suitable for federal employment.
- Must participate in the direct deposit pay program.
- Within the Department of Defense (DoD), the appointment of retired military members within 180 days immediately following retirement date to a civilian position is subject to the provisions of 5 United States Code 3326.
- Males born after 12-31-59 must be registered for Selective Service.
- You will be required to obtain and maintain an interim and/or final security clearance prior to entrance on duty. Failure to obtain and maintain the required level of clearance may result in the withdrawal of a job offer or removal.
- This position is covered under the Defense Acquisition Workforce Improvement Act (DAWIA). Certification in the Functional Area and Tier assigned to the position, along with Continuous Learning (CL) points, are required within established timeframes.
- This position may require travel from normal duty station to CONUS and OCONUS and may include remote or isolated sites. You must be able to travel on military and commercial aircraft for extended periods of time.
